The Nokia X7-00 is a Symbian^3 smartphone from the Nokia Xseries. It is the first Xseries phone with Nokia's Symbian^3 platform and it shipped with the Anna update. It is also the successor to X6, which was the previous multimedia touchscreen phone, with similar features and specifications in the series. The X7-00 was announced on 12 April 2011,[2] alongside the Nokia E6.[3]
Features
- WCDMA
- Size: 119.7 × 62.8 × 11.9mm
- Display: 4.0-inch; AMOLED, 16 million colors.
- Screen resolution: 640x360 pixels (184ppi)
- Scratch-resistant capacitive touchscreen
- Integrated and Assisted GPS
- Wireless LAN (Wi-Fi)

Operating times
- Talk time: Up to 6 hours 30 minutes
- Standby time: Up to 450 hours
- Music playback: Up to 50 hours
- Video playback: Up to 20 hours
